squadrons

word · lemma: squadron

Definition

A 'squadron' is a group of military aircraft, ships, or soldiers organized to work together as a unit. The word is often used in air forces and navies.

Usage & Nuances

Usually formal and military-related. Common contexts: 'air squadrons,' 'naval squadrons.' Do not confuse 'squadron' (large, military, organized) with 'squad' (smaller group, more informal in modern usage).
